Psoriatic arthritis (PsA) is a chronic inflammatory disease that can be progressive and may be associated with permanent joint damage and disability. Early identification of PsA will enable these patients with progressive disease to be treated early and aggressively. Paracetamol is a commonly used NSAID (Non-steroidal anti-inflammatory agent) since its introduction by Von Mering in 1893. Its popularity is because of its long safety record and good efficacy in children and adults. Though it has been used for so many years, its mechanism of action is yet to be elucidated.
